🛠️ Envyro: Environment Configuration Simplified

Envyro is a modern configuration format and CLI tool for managing environment variables across multiple environments like dev, prod, stage, and local. It uses a custom .envyro format that supports nesting, multi-env inline values, and structured scoping.


🔍 Features

1. 🔄 Convert .envyro to .env

Generate traditional .env files for a specific environment by parsing a structured .envyro file.

Command:

envyro export --env dev

2. 📤 Export Environment Variables to Shell

Directly export variables to your current shell environment for a given environment.

Command:

source <(envyro export --env dev --shell)

3. 📦 Split .envyro into Multiple .env Files

Break a single .envyro file into multiple .env files like .env.dev, .env.prod, etc.

Command:

envyro split

🧪 Example .envyro Format

[envs]
environments = prod, dev, stage, local
default = dev

[app]
name = "MyApp"
version = [prod]:1.0.0 [dev]:0.1.0 [stage]:0.2.0 [local]:0.3.0
description = "Unified app config"
author = "John Doe"

[db]
host = [prod]:prod-db.example.com [*]:localhost
port = 5432
user = [prod]:prod_user [*]:local_user
password = [prod]:prod_pass [*]:dev_pass

[aws.s3]
bucket = [prod]:prod-bucket [dev]:dev-bucket [stage]:stage-bucket [local]:local-bucket
region = [*]:us-east-1

[aws.sns]
topic = [prod]:arn:aws:sns:us-west-1:123456789012:prod-topic [dev]:arn:aws:sns:us-west-2:123456789012:dev-topic

🧠 Advantages of .envyro

  • ✅ Supports nesting like [aws.s3], [db.connection]
  • Single-file config for all environments
  • ✅ Allows default ([*]) and environment-specific values
  • ✅ Cleaner and more maintainable than multiple .env files
  • ✅ Easy to convert into .env, .yaml, or Python dict

🧰 Installation

You can install envyro as a local tool (coming soon as a CLI tool). For now, clone and run manually.

git clone https://github.com/your-org/envyro
cd envyro
python3 -m venv .venv
source .venv/bin/activate
pip install -r requirements.txt
python main.py
